Transaction ecaf213d81b6b822460fb7807bf7545958e7bab233ffe0565266a4cf24ab9637
1 Input
1 Output
-
ecaf213d81b6b822460fb7807bf7545958e7bab233ffe0565266a4cf24ab9637:0
- value
- 364300
- script pubkey
- OP_0 OP_PUSHBYTES_20 89525d93af1d5a7cad2969e85b85015f9779d0dd
- address
- bc1q39f9mya0r4d8etffd859hpgpt7thn5xawxnf29